Dallas-based Tenet Healthcare saw the greatest increase, 21.7 percent.
Here’s how the operators stacked up as of July 26:
- Community Health Systems (Franklin, Tenn.): $2.15 per share (down 1.8 percent)
- HCA Healthcare (Nashville, Tenn.): $145.06 per share (up 4 percent)
- Tenet Healthcare: $22.01 per share (up 21.7 percent)
- Universal Health Services (King of Prussia, Pa.): $151.89 per share (up 14.5 percent)
